Nerlens Noel still technically a member of the 2013 class
Posted Feb 17, 2012
Much has been made of former Everett and current Tilton boys basketball star Nerlens Noel’s decision to reclassify into the Class of 2012. While sources have told the Herald that the 6-foot-10 center will likely be granted his request (possibly as early as next week), the fact of the matter is, as of right now, he is still considered a member of the Class of 2013 in the eyes of the school (and more importantly, the NCAA).
